Much of the coffee crop was damaged by Hurricane Maria, but since then, a lot of work is being done to help both the coffee plants and coffee farmers recover. Coffee is a traditional crop in Puerto Rico and the coffee is grown in Puerto Rico in the western mountain region which offers ideal growing conditions. But there are challenges ahead! Did you know?

Herbs and spices can come from rhizomes, flower buds, bulbs, barks, stigmas, fruits, leaves or seeds. Many of the most prized herbs and spices come from the tropical world (saffron, cinnamon, cardamom, pepper, vanilla, etc.).
